Bebe Rexha consolidates global success with live video of “Sad Girls” in Ibiza

Bebe Rexha is living one of the most triumphant moments of her career, solidifying her hit “New Religion” as one of the dominant summer songs in the Northern Hemisphere. To crown her global success, the American singer-songwriter has released a live video of “Sad Girls,” a new partnership with French DJ and producer David Guetta, recorded directly from Ibiza.

Both songs are standout tracks from her recently released album DIRTY BLONDE, a project launched independently by EMPIRE that has earned the artist an unprecedented top spot on the Top Dance Albums chart in the United States, symbolizing a new era of total creative autonomy and control over her career.

“‘This album represents a deep exercise of confidence and autonomy. After years of intense experiences, both personally and professionally, ‘DIRTY BLONDE’ emerges as my most honest and unfiltered portrait. I’m taking ownership of my choices and contrasts with total consciousness, and it’s wonderful to be able to deliver a project made exactly the way I want,” Bebe Rexha explains.

With a career marked by both solo releases and high-profile collaborations, she continues to reaffirm her role as one of the most relevant voices in contemporary pop music. Between sold-out tours and performances at major festivals around the world, the artist continues to captivate audiences with her intensity, reflected in her new phase – recently, she delivered one of the most acclaimed performances at Rock in Rio Lisbon. By breaking free from traditional market constraints and embracing her own experiences, the star delivers a disc that is both a celebration of club culture and a vulnerable confessional.

The strength of the project is reflected in impressive numbers around the globe. With over 125 entries on Shazam and a peak of #14 on the Top 200 Global chart, “New Religion” has become one of the summer’s top hits in Europe, entering the Top 50 on Spotify in various territories, as well as prominent positions on UK, German, French, and Portuguese radio stations. Brazil is not far behind, ranking as the third-largest market globally for the song’s consumption on platforms.

The single “Sad Girls” does not lag behind, reaching the 9th spot on US Dance Music radio stations, surpassing 2.5 million weekly streams in France, achieving strong rotation in Australia and New Zealand. This warm reception directly reflected in the demand for her shows, causing tickets for her performance at the prestigious KOKO London in London to sell out in under 12 hours.
